ssl相关内容
我正在尝试对具有2个SSL证书的站点进行HTTPS调用:一个自签名证书和一个由第一个证书签名的证书。当我使用HttpClient向站点发送请求时,控制台记录一个不受信任的链,显示两个证书,然后打印由java.security.cert.CertPathValidatorException: Trust anchor for certification path not found引起的长堆栈跟踪。
..
我的操作系统是Windows 10 64位。我使用的是最新版本的Firefox和Chrome。 我要保存预主密钥以便与Wireshark一起使用。 为此,我找到了许多教程,都推荐使用SSLKEYLOGFILE环境变量。 然而,无论我在这个变量中输入了什么路径,Firefox(普通版和开发者版)或Chrome都没有创建任何文件。即使当我重新启动这些浏览器或操作系统时也是如此。当我清除浏
..
我使用的是python3.8 我在我的Ubuntu系统上得到以下输出: >>> import ssl >>> ssl.OPENSSL_VERSION 'OpenSSL 1.1.1f 31 Mar 2020' >>> ssl.PROTOCOL_TLSv1_2 我正在尝试通过TLS使用MODBUS TCP连接,因此我在#wa
..
我不理解这个SSLpem文件问题。我正在尝试使用证书确保一个Mongo实例的安全。我需要传递的参数之一是pem文件。 --tlsCertificateKeyFile=/data/ssl/mysite.pem 问题是我从CA获得的压缩文件没有.pem文件。然而,阅读谷歌文章,我似乎只需要将其中一个证书文件重命名为.pem?我试了几次,但不是所有的都没有成功。在尝试这些文件时,我还删除了换行
..
如果这不是正确的SO(信息安全或加密),我立即道歉。无论如何,我正在尝试找出如何在Python中验证SSL证书客户端。我发现了一个回调函数here,它看起来与我在网上看到的其他函数相似。然而,在我的代码中,我不确定它是如何工作的(或者为什么,实际上)。当我运行我的代码时,它似乎可以工作,但是为什么(在PyCharm中)前四个参数是灰色的,而只有第五个参数是白色的?是否有方法可以使用此回调函数来检查
..
我的应用程序是一种“Web Screper”形式,它使用the Java Jsoup library从所需的输入页面加载HTML。我最近将我的应用程序平台从Java 8升级到Java 11。在这次升级中,我收到了几个来自我的客户的报告,他们说他们在试图加载某些网页的HTML内容时收到SSLHandshakeExceptions。发生这些情况的网页因设备而异,并且在某些设备上,我的客户端根本无法加载
..
在节点https module docs中, Http://请求: const options = { hostname: 'encrypted.google.com', port: 443, path: '/', method: 'GET', key: fs.readFileSync('test/fixtures/keys/agent2-key.pem'), cer
..
使用.NET Core 2.2时,我需要重新创建一个不完整的链SSL错误,但是ServerCerficateValidationCallback提供给我的证书链与我预期的不同,这些证书通过了验证。有人能解释一下这里出了什么问题吗? 调用badssl.com的独立测试: public void DoTheThing() { string URI = "ht
..
我按照这本DigitalOcean指南https://www.digitalocean.com/community/tutorials/how-to-set-up-an-nginx-ingress-with-cert-manager-on-digitalocean-kubernetes,发现了一些很奇怪的事情。当我在主机名中设置通配符时,letsencrypt颁发新证书失败。而当我只设置定义的子域
..
我已从name.com获得证书。 ➜ tree . . ├── ca.crt ├── vpk.crt ├── vpk.csr └── vpk.key 我是如何创建秘密的 我在vpk.crt文件的末尾添加了ca.crt内容。 (⎈ | vpk-dev-eks:argocd) ➜ k create secret tls tls-secret --cert=vpk.crt
..
我正在尝试为Kubernetes群集(AWS EKS)之外可用的服务设置TLS。使用cert-Manager,我已经成功地颁发了证书并配置了入口,但仍然收到错误NET::ERR_CERT_AUTHORITY_INVALID。这是我所拥有的: 名称空间tests和hello-kubernetes(部署和服务都有名称hello-kubernetes-first,Servce是port80和tar
..
我正在尝试将客户端证书发送到需要该证书的Web服务器。 如果我从命令行cURL命令发出请求,它就会工作。 我传递了--key文件名和--cert文件名,一切正常。 当我在libcurl库中执行此操作时,我执行以下操作: curl_easy_setopt(curl, CURLOPT_SSLCERT, client_cert_file.c_str()); curl_e
..
我正在尝试使用libcurl调用REST API。 我的服务器环境:Oracle TUXEDO(PRO*C)、AIX 7.1 在提示符下使用命令“curl”确实可以工作。 我还可以使用详细选项查看整个日志。 但当我尝试在使用libcurl的客户端编译时使用它时,它一直停止。 根据日志。 上面写着… 正在尝试123.456.789.00:443… 连接到“API
..
下面this cli command: npm run webpack-dev-server --mode development --open --cert=../../ssl/server.pem --key=../../ssl/server.pem 我要将这些文件添加到我的webpack.config文件中。类似于: module.exports = { ...
..
我创建这个“问题”是为了记录我如何能够在本地设置SSL,以防将来需要再次这样做。我想把它记录在这里,希望这也能对其他人有所帮助,因为这是一个棘手的过程。 我在Mac上使用High Sierra、MamP v 4.2.1和Chrome v 71 好了,我们走吧。 推荐答案 1)为本地主机创建SSL证书 为了能够对localhost使用HTTPS,我们实际上需要两个证书:
..
我已经有一个.pem和一个.key文件,我不想在本地安装/导入它,只告诉我的客户端使用它们,可以吗?它不是自签名证书 基本上,在我的卷发中,我正在做这样的事情: curl --key mykey.key --cert mycert.pem https://someurl.com/my-endpoint 我已检查此答案 How to make https request wit
..
我当前正在使用node-postgres创建我的池。这是我当前的代码: const { Pool } = require('pg') const pgPool = new Pool({ user: process.env.PGUSER, password: process.env.PGPASSWORD, host: process.env.PGHOST, database:
..
在我正在开发的应用程序中,我需要处理来自我们的支付服务提供商的3D安全重定向。这些重定向指向向应用程序中的用户显示的WKWebView中的发卡商网页。 除WKWebView无法为https://3dsecure.csas.cz/加载并失败并出现以下错误之外,其他情况除外: Error Domain=NSURLErrorDomain Code=-1200 "An SSL error ha
..
我正在尝试在RHEL上编译PYTHON,因为我当前的PYTHON使用的是旧的1.0.2k SSL版本。 (test_env) [brad@reason tlscheck]$ python3 --version Python 3.9.3 (test_env) [brad@reason tlscheck]$ python3 -c "import ssl; print(ssl.OPENSSL_VE
..
我正在尝试使用wget检索资源,但不断收到以下错误: Unable to establish SSL connection. 我尝试了以下命令: wget -d https://resourcesource.com/spring-boot-starter-parent-2.0.0.RELEASE.pom wget --no-check-certificate -d https:/
..